數據庫與數據庫用戶的異同 (數據庫和數據庫用戶的區別)
在當今數字化的世界中,數據庫和數據庫用戶是信息技術領域中不可或缺的兩個概念。雖然它們在功能和角色上有著明顯的區別,但它們之間的關係卻是密不可分的。本文將深入探討數據庫與數據庫用戶的異同,幫助讀者更好地理解這兩者的定義、功能及其相互作用。
什麼是數據庫?
數據庫是一種有組織的數據集合,通常存儲在計算機系統中,並能夠通過特定的查詢語言(如SQL)進行訪問和管理。數據庫的主要目的是高效地存儲、檢索和管理數據。根據數據的結構,數據庫可以分為多種類型,包括:
- 關係型數據庫:使用表格來存儲數據,並通過行和列的方式組織數據,如MySQL、PostgreSQL等。
- 非關係型數據庫:不使用表格結構,適合存儲大規模的非結構化數據,如MongoDB、Cassandra等。
- 分佈式數據庫:數據分散存儲在多個位置,適合大規模應用,如Google Bigtable。
什麼是數據庫用戶?
數據庫用戶是指能夠訪問和操作數據庫的個體或應用程序。數據庫用戶可以是人類用戶(如數據庫管理員、開發者)或自動化系統(如應用程序或服務)。數據庫用戶的主要職責包括:
- 數據訪問:用戶可以根據權限訪問數據庫中的數據。
- 數據操作:用戶可以執行查詢、插入、更新和刪除等操作。
- 數據管理:用戶可以管理數據庫的結構和性能,包括創建和修改表格、索引等。
數據庫與數據庫用戶的異同
相同點
數據庫和數據庫用戶之間有一些共同點:
- 相互依賴:數據庫用戶需要數據庫來存儲和檢索數據,而數據庫則需要用戶來進行操作和管理。
- 安全性:兩者都需要考慮安全性問題,數據庫需要設置用戶權限,而用戶則需要遵循安全操作規範。
不同點
儘管數據庫和數據庫用戶之間有相似之處,但它們的本質和功能卻有顯著的區別:
- 定義:數據庫是數據的集合,而數據庫用戶是能夠訪問和操作這些數據的個體或系統。
- 功能:數據庫的主要功能是存儲和管理數據,而數據庫用戶的功能則是訪問和操作這些數據。
- 角色:數據庫通常由數據庫管理系統(DBMS)來管理,而數據庫用戶則是與數據庫進行交互的實體。
結論
總結來說,數據庫和數據庫用戶在信息技術中扮演著不同但互補的角色。數據庫作為數據的存儲和管理系統,為用戶提供了高效的數據訪問和操作能力。而數據庫用戶則是利用這些能力來實現業務需求和數據分析。理解這兩者的異同,不僅有助於提升數據管理的效率,也能夠幫助企業更好地利用數據資源。